The way we treat addicts is surprising. We call them lazy, irresponsible, and aimless people who just want to get high. But there is something we all have been missing. Most people don’t get addicted for the sake of pleasure; they are trying to escape reality. To be precise, they are trying to numb their suffering.

It is easy to say, ‘why can’t just quit when you know it’s harmful?’ We cannot provide assistance and support, but we are just treating the symptoms. Addiction should be treated at root levels. We need to ask why they became addicts in the first place. Have they been through traumatic episodes? What’s that they are lacking in their life?’
